WebApr 6, 2024 · Beans and peas, being plant-based foods, are linked to decreased risk of inflammatory diseases. 1 Also research has revealed that only 50% or less of the phosphorus in legumes is absorbed. Phytates in plant protein binds phosphorus, preventing absorption. 2 Concerns in addition to phosphorus, another concern when including … WebA diet high in fruits, vegetables, nuts, whole grains and olive oil is associated with a lower risk of prediabetes. WebSep 30, 2024 · Eat Peanuts to Prevent Kidney Disease Resveratrol in peanuts is linked to prevention of cancer, aging, type 2 di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and now chronic … WebResveratrol has long been studied for its benefits in treating cancer, type 2 diabetes, and cardiovascular disease. 2. Resveratrol is only found in a few foods, including peanuts, mulberries, grape skins and wine. Eating a handful of peanuts everyday provides more resveratrol than a glass of red wine. 3.
